Abstract

A scrambling method for multicast channels with coexisting internal and external encryption modes comprises the following steps: the channel production control center platform generates a corresponding multicast channel forwarding task request carrying encryption parameters according to the security level grade of the channel and sends the multicast channel forwarding task request to a multicast forwarding server; the multicast forwarding server encrypts the video data of the multicast channel internally or externally according to the encryption parameters and sets a head identifier when encrypting the video data of the multicast channel; and the client player receives the encrypted multicast channel video data, and decrypts and plays the encrypted multicast channel video data according to the head identifier. The invention also provides a multicast channel scrambling system with the internal and external encryption dual modes, which is used for scrambling the channels with the common safety requirement by adopting an internal encryption mode; the channel required by the high-level security level is scrambled in an external encryption mode, so that the video content is not illegally played, and the video can be played in the channel with the common security level under the condition that an uplink network cannot be communicated.

Technical Field
The invention relates to the technical field of an interactive network television IPTV, in particular to a scrambling method and a scrambling system of video data in a single-direction and two-direction network environment.
Background
In the prior art, Multicast channel video data is transmitted by using Multicast, and there are two schemes:
1. multicast clear stream transmission: the multicast channel data is not scrambled and is directly sent to the client player, and all players with the multicast address can play without decryption.
2. All channels are encrypted, and a key needs to be acquired from the key management server, so that the client player is required to access the key management server at any time, and the channels cannot be played under the conditions that an uplink network is not communicated and a downlink network is communicated.

Detailed Description
The preferred embodiments of the present invention will be described in conjunction with the accompanying drawings, and it will be understood that they are described herein for the purpose of illustration and explanation and not limitation.
Fig. 1 is a block diagram of a multicast channel scrambling system with coexistence of internal and external encryption modes according to the present invention, and as shown in fig. 1, the multicast channel scrambling system with coexistence of internal and external encryption modes according to the present invention includes a channel production control center platform 101, a multicast forwarding server 102, a key management server 103, and a client player 104, wherein,
the channel production control center platform 101 receives the security level of the preset channel input by the user according to the service requirement, generates a corresponding multicast channel forwarding task request carrying the encryption parameter, and sends the multicast channel forwarding task request to the multicast forwarding server 102.
In the invention, if the received security level is a common security level, the channel production control center platform 101 generates a multicast channel forwarding task request, and the carried encryption parameters comprise an inner encryption level parameter; if the received security level is a high security level, the generated multicast channel forwards the task request, the encryption parameters carried by the task request include an external encryption level parameter, a key version number and a key, and the key version number and the key are sent to the key management server 103.
A multicast forwarding server 102, which receives a multicast channel forwarding task request carrying encryption parameters issued by a channel production control center platform 101, and analyzes the multicast channel forwarding task request to obtain an information source address and encryption parameters; acquiring multicast channel video data according to the information source address, and encrypting the multicast channel video data by using an internal encryption mode or an external encryption mode according to encryption parameters; the encrypted multicast channel video data is forwarded to the corresponding client player 104.
In the present invention, if the encryption parameter includes an inner encryption level parameter, the multicast forwarding server 102 sets the header identifier of the encrypted multicast channel video data to an inner encryption mode. The header identification of the multicast channel video data encrypted by the internal encryption mode comprises: an internal and external encryption identifier and an encryption identifier; wherein, the inner encryption mode is represented when the inner and outer encryption mark is 01, and the outer encryption mode is represented when the inner and outer encryption mark is 02; an encryption identifier, which represents no encryption when 00; and 01 indicates encryption.
And if the encryption parameters comprise an outer encryption level grade parameter, a key version number and a key, setting the head identification of the encrypted multicast channel video data to be in an outer encryption mode. The header identification of the multicast channel video data encrypted by using the external encryption mode comprises: an internal and external encryption identifier, an encryption identifier and a key version number; wherein, the inner encryption mode is represented when the inner and outer encryption mark is 01, and the outer encryption mode is represented when the inner and outer encryption mark is 02; an encryption identifier, which represents no encryption when 00; when 01, encryption is represented; the key version number is 4 bytes, e.g., 000A.
A key management server 103 which stores and manages the received key version number and key transmitted from the channel production control center platform 101; the request of the client player 104 is received, and the key is sent to the client player 104 after the login credentials are verified.
And the client player 104 receives the encrypted multicast channel video data sent by the multicast forwarding server 102, analyzes the header identifier of the encrypted multicast channel video data, judges the encryption mode, and decrypts and plays the encrypted multicast channel video data according to the judgment result.
If the analyzed head mark is an inner encryption mode, the client player 104 of the invention directly uses the built-in secret key to decrypt and play the video data of the encrypted multicast channel; if the analyzed head identifier includes an external encryption mode and a key version number, the decryption request information carrying the key version number and the login credentials is sent to the key management server 103 in an https manner, and the external encryption decryption key is obtained to decrypt and play the encrypted multicast channel video data.
Fig. 2 is a flowchart of a method for scrambling a multicast channel with coexistence of internal and external encryption modes according to the present invention, and the method for scrambling a multicast channel with coexistence of internal and external encryption modes according to the present invention will be described in detail with reference to fig. 2.
Firstly, in step 201, the channel production control center platform 101 receives the security level of the channel input by the user according to the service requirement;
in this step, the security level levels of the received channel include a general security level and an advanced security level.
In step 202, the security level of the channel is determined, and if the channel is a normal security level, the step 203 is performed, and if the channel is a high security level, the step 204 is performed.
In step 203, multicast forwarding server 102 encrypts the video data of the multicast channel in the inner encryption mode and sends the encrypted video data to client player 104.
In step 204, multicast forwarding server 102 encrypts the video data of the multicast channel in the outer encryption mode and sends the encrypted video data to client player 104.
In step 205, the client player 104 receives the encrypted multicast channel video data sent by the multicast forwarding server 102, decrypts the encrypted multicast channel video data, and plays the encrypted multicast channel video data.
Fig. 3 is a flowchart of an intra encryption mode method according to the present invention, and the intra encryption mode method of the present invention will be described in detail with reference to fig. 3.
Firstly, in step 301, the channel production control center platform 101 sends an internal encryption multicast channel forwarding task request to the multicast forwarding server 102; wherein, the task request for forwarding the internal encryption multicast channel carries the encryption parameter containing the grade parameter of the internal encryption level.
In step 302, the multicast forwarding server 102 parses the intra-encrypted multicast channel forwarding task request to obtain the encryption parameters and the channel source address.
In step 303, the multicast forwarding server 102 downloads the multicast channel video data according to the channel source address;
in step 304, the multicast forwarding server 102 confirms the internal encryption type according to the encryption parameter, performs internal encryption on the video data of the multicast channel, and sets the head identifier of the encrypted video data of the multicast channel to be in an internal encryption mode; the encrypted multicast channel video data is sent to the corresponding client player 104. The destination address and port forwarded by the multicast forwarding server 102 are derived from the corresponding parameter fields in the multicast channel forwarding task request.
The header identification of the multicast channel video data encrypted by the internal encryption mode comprises: an internal and external encryption identifier and an encryption identifier; wherein, the inner encryption mode is represented when the inner and outer encryption mark is 01, and the outer encryption mode is represented when the inner and outer encryption mark is 02; an encryption identifier, which represents no encryption when 00; and 01 indicates encryption.
In step 305, the client player 104 parses the received encrypted multicast channel video data, confirms the internal encryption type, and decrypts and plays the encrypted multicast channel video data using the internal key.
Fig. 4 is a flowchart of an outer cipher mode method according to the present invention, which will be described in detail with reference to fig. 4.
Firstly, in step 401, the channel production control center platform 101 sends an external encryption multicast channel forwarding task request to the multicast forwarding server 102, and sends a key version number and a key to the key management server 103; the external encryption multicast channel forwarding task request carries encryption parameters including an external encryption level grade parameter, a key version number and a key.
In step 402, the multicast forwarding server 102 parses the external encrypted multicast channel forwarding task request to obtain an encryption parameter and a channel source address.
In step 403, the multicast forwarding server 102 downloads the multicast channel video data according to the channel source address;
in step 404, the multicast forwarding server 102 confirms the external encryption type according to the encryption parameter, and uses the key to perform external encryption on the video data of the multicast channel according to the encryption parameter, and sets the head identifier of the external encryption mode at the head of the encrypted video data of the multicast channel; the encrypted multicast channel video data is sent to the corresponding client player 104. The destination address and port forwarded by the multicast forwarding server 102 are derived from the corresponding parameter fields in the multicast forwarding task request.
The header identification of the multicast channel video data encrypted by using the external encryption mode comprises: an internal and external encryption identifier, an encryption identifier and a key version number; wherein, the inner encryption mode is represented when the inner and outer encryption mark is 01, and the outer encryption mode is represented when the inner and outer encryption mark is 02; an encryption identifier, which represents no encryption when 00; when 01, encryption is represented; the key version number is 4 bytes, e.g., 000A.
In step 405, the client player 104 parses the received encrypted multicast channel video data, confirms the external encryption type, and sends the decryption request information carrying the key version number and the login credentials to the key management server 103; the key management server 103 parses the received decryption request information, verifies the login credential according to the key version number, and sends the key to the client player 104.
In step 406, the client player 104 decrypts and plays the encrypted multicast channel video data using the received key.
